<p style="text-align: center;"><strong>This is a four-week class complete with screen capture tutorial, handouts, and homework.<br />
You don’t need to be on your computer at any specific time.</strong></p>
<p>You may watch any or all of the videos from three choices of software. You may use Photoshop, Photoshop Elements, or the FREE software, Gimp. Watch the video and pause it to work along, after you’ve completed an area, go back to the video and continue watching, it’s that easy. Or, watch the videos completely and then try it yourself. I’ve covered the same materials in each piece of software and in the videos; however, I may have explained it a little differently, so if you would like to watch any or all of the software videos, go for it.<span id="more-1087"></span></p>
